DELSU notice on CES 311 registration for 2nd semester, 2025/2026
Students in specific faculties at Delta State University, Abraka, are now required to register for the compulsory skill acquisition course, CES 311 (Skill Acquisition), for the second semester of the 2025/2026 session.
In an internal memorandum dated February 2026, the Director of the Centre for Entrepreneurial Studies, Professor Onoriode O. Emoyan, announced that registration is now open for eligible students. The directive specifically targets 300-level students, as well as 400-level students who are yet to take the course, from the Faculties of Education, Science, Basic Medical Science, Pharmacy, Allied Health Sciences, Dentistry, Engineering, and Law.
According to the memo, these faculties are scheduled for their training in the second semester, following the approved institutional schedule. Students from other faculties who were unable to participate in the first semester training are also encouraged to take advantage of this second semester window to complete the requirement.
The registration process requires students to visit the Centre for Entrepreneurial Studies to select from the available skill options, indicating their preferences. The Centre noted that this collation is essential to finalize logistics and commence training for the second semester.
The university has set a firm deadline for the exercise. All affected students are advised to complete their registration on or before 27th March, 2026.
The memorandum has been distributed to the Deputy Vice-Chancellor (Academics), Deans, Heads of Department, and the Student Union Government for wider dissemination. Students are urged to check departmental notice boards for further details.
